Merge pull request #10 from djmitche/pyflakes

Pyflakes
This commit is contained in:
Matsumoto Taichi 2012-04-05 21:16:47 -07:00
commit d7ce6b280e
2 changed files with 4 additions and 8 deletions

View File

@ -3,7 +3,7 @@
import re
from time import time, mktime
from datetime import datetime, date
from datetime import datetime
from dateutil.relativedelta import relativedelta
search_re = re.compile(r'^([^-]+)-([^-/]+)(/(.*))?$')
@ -145,11 +145,9 @@ class croniter(object):
def _calc(self, now, expanded, is_prev):
if is_prev:
nearest_method = self._get_prev_nearest
nearest_diff_method = self._get_prev_nearest_diff
sign = -1
else:
nearest_method = self._get_next_nearest
nearest_diff_method = self._get_next_nearest_diff
sign = 1
@ -232,7 +230,7 @@ class croniter(object):
if expanded[5][0] != '*':
diff_sec = nearest_diff_method(d.second, expanded[5], 60)
if diff_sec != None and diff_sec != 0:
dst += relativedelta(seconds = diff_sec)
d += relativedelta(seconds = diff_sec)
return True, d
else:
d += relativedelta(second = 0)

View File

@ -2,8 +2,7 @@
# -*- coding: utf-8 -*-
import unittest
import time
from datetime import datetime, date
from datetime import datetime
from croniter import croniter
class CroniterTest(unittest.TestCase):
@ -120,7 +119,6 @@ class CroniterTest(unittest.TestCase):
self.assertEqual(n4.year, 2011)
def testError(self):
base = datetime(2010, 1, 25)
itr = croniter('* * * * *')
self.assertRaises(TypeError, itr.get_next, str)
self.assertRaises(ValueError, croniter, '* * * *')
@ -179,7 +177,7 @@ class CroniterTest(unittest.TestCase):
self.assertEqual(prev3.hour, 0)
self.assertEqual(prev3.minute, 0)
def testPrevWeekDay(self):
def testPrevWeekDay2(self):
base = datetime(2010, 8, 25, 15, 56)
itr = croniter('10 0 * * 0', base)
prev = itr.get_prev(datetime)